Wider Curriculum

Over the next few weeks the children will be learning:

  • Key information about significant nurses from the past (Florence Nightingale, Mary Seacole, Edith Cavell) and the impact they had on nursing.
  • How to group animals into categories.
  • What animals need to survive.
  • The life cycles of a variety of animals as well as the offspring they have.
  • How to draw inspiration from their environment in their artwork.
  • How to use a range of materials and techniques to make sketches.

Maths

This half term, the children will be learning about:

  • Numbers to 100
  • Partitioning numbers into tens and ones
  • Number bonds
  • Methods for adding and subtracting (to and within 100)
